Senior Business Development Specialist Salary in New Mexico

How much does a Senior Business Development Specialist make in New Mexico?

As of August 01, 2026, the average salary for a Senior Business Development Specialist in New Mexico is $163,960 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$79.

However, a Senior Business Development Specialist's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$175,182
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$147,619 to $169,834
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$132,741

How Experience Level Affects Senior Business Development Specialist Salaries?

Experience is a primary driver of a Senior Business Development Specialist's salary. As you build your skills and take on more complex tasks, your compensation generally increases. Here’s how the average salary grows at different career stages:

  • Entry-Level (less than 1 year): $108,677
  • Early Career (1-2 years): $125,508
  • Mid-Level (2-4 years): $165,094
  • Senior-Level (5-8 years): $199,917
  • Expert (over 8 years): $257,060

Senior Business Development Specialist Salary by Industry: Top Paying Sectors

For Senior Business Development Specialist roles, the industry you choose can affect earning potential by as much as 40% (the gap between the highest and lowest paying industries). Data shows that the Software & Networking and Aerospace & Defense sectors offer the strongest compensation, at 20% above the average. In contrast, Senior Business Development Specialist positions in Retail & Wholesale or Transportation typically offer lower base pay, as these industries often view Senior Business Development Specialist as a support function rather than a direct revenue driver.
